What Is Slot Volatility?

Volatility, also called variance, measures how often a slot machine pays out and how large those payouts tend to be. Think of it as the risk-reward balance built into every game. Low volatility slots pay frequently but with smaller prizes, while high volatility games deliver bigger wins but less often.

Low vs. High Volatility Slots

Low volatility slots are ideal if you prefer steady, consistent returns. You’ll enjoy more frequent wins, though they’ll typically be modest. These games suit players with smaller bankrolls or those seeking longer gaming sessions.

High volatility slots appeal to thrill-seekers chasing substantial payouts. You might experience longer dry spells, but when you do win, the rewards can be significant. These games require a larger bankroll and more patience.
